Day 1

Arrival in Addis Ababa – City Tour

Arrival in Addis Ababa – City Tour

Welcome to Addis Ababa, the vibrant capital city of Ethiopia. Upon arrival, you will be welcomed at the airport and transferred to your hotel. Depending on your arrival time, enjoy a guided city tour including the National Museum, home of the famous fossil Lucy, Holy Trinity Cathedral, and panoramic views from Mount Entoto. You will also experience the lively atmosphere of Mercato, one of Africa’s largest open-air markets.

Day 2

Flight to Bahir Dar – Lake Tana Monasteries

Flight to Bahir Dar – Lake Tana Monasteries

Take a morning domestic flight to Bahir Dar, beautifully situated on the shores of Lake Tana. After check-in, enjoy a relaxing boat trip across the lake to visit the historic Ura Kidane Mehret Monastery, famous for its colorful religious paintings and ancient manuscripts. Later, explore the lakeside city and local markets.

Day 3

Blue Nile Falls – Drive to Gondar

Blue Nile Falls – Drive to Gondar

In the morning, visit the magnificent Blue Nile Falls, locally known as “Tis Issat,” meaning “Smoking Water.” Enjoy a short scenic walk around the falls before returning to Bahir Dar. After lunch, drive through the beautiful Ethiopian highlands to Gondar, the former royal capital of Ethiopia.

Day 4

Gondar -Simien Mountains National Park

Gondar -Simien Mountains National Park

Drive to the breathtaking Simien Mountains National Park, one of Africa’s most dramatic mountain ranges and a UNESCO World Heritage Site. Enjoy spectacular scenery, deep valleys, cliffs, and unique wildlife. During the excursion, you may encounter Gelada baboons, Walia ibex, and various endemic bird species while enjoying short hikes and panoramic viewpoints.

Day 6

Flight to Lalibela – First Cluster Churches

Flight to Lalibela – First Cluster Churches

Take a morning flight to Lalibela, home to Ethiopia’s most famous rock-hewn churches. In the afternoon, visit the first cluster of churches carved directly into solid rock during the 12th century. Learn about the fascinating history, architecture, and spiritual importance of this UNESCO World Heritage Site.

Day 8

Flight to Axum

Flight to Axum

Fly to Axum, the ancient center of the Axumite Kingdom and one of Africa’s oldest civilizations. Visit the impressive stelae field, archaeological sites, royal tombs, and the Church of St. Mary of Zion, believed by many Ethiopians to house the Ark of the Covenant.

Day 9

Around Axum – Yeha Temple

Around Axum – Yeha Temple

Today, drive to visit Yeha Temple, Ethiopia’s oldest standing structure dating back over 2,500 years. Continue exploring ancient churches and archaeological remains around Axum while learning about Ethiopia’s rich historical and religious heritage.

Day 11

Mekele – Hawzen – Gheralta Mountains

Mekele – Hawzen – Gheralta Mountains

Depart Mekele and journey toward the dramatic Gheralta Mountains, known for their rugged sandstone formations and ancient cliff monasteries. After lunch, visit churches such as Abuna Yemata Guh or Mariam Korkor, famous for their challenging climbs, ancient frescoes, and spectacular panoramic views.

Day 14

Addis Ababa – Arba Minch

Addis Ababa – Arba Minch

Take a morning flight to Arba Minch. Upon arrival, enjoy a scenic boat excursion on Lake Chamo to visit the famous “Crocodile Market,” where large Nile crocodiles, hippos, and abundant birdlife can be seen. Later, continue to Nechisar National Park for a game drive before visiting the Dorze people in the Guge Mountains, known for their bamboo houses and weaving traditions.

Day 15

Arba Minch – Konso – Turmi

Arba Minch – Konso – Turmi

After breakfast, drive through scenic Rift Valley landscapes toward Turmi. En route, visit the UNESCO-listed Konso Cultural Landscape, famous for its stone terraces and traditional villages. Continue to Turmi, home of the Hamer people, recognized for their colorful clothing, unique hairstyles, and cultural traditions.

Day 16

Kara & Nyangatom Tribes

Kara & Nyangatom Tribes

Today, explore the rich tribal cultures of the Omo Valley. Visit the Kara (Karo) people along the Omo River, famous for elaborate body painting and scarification traditions. Continue to meet the Nyangatom tribe, semi-nomadic pastoralists with a strong traditional identity. Along the route, enjoy beautiful landscapes, birdlife, and cultural photography opportunities.

Day 18

Mursi Tribe – Fly Addis Ababa – Departure

Mursi Tribe – Fly Addis Ababa – Departure

Early in the morning, drive into Mago National Park to visit the famous Mursi Tribe, known for the women’s clay lip plates and strong cultural traditions. Enjoy authentic cultural interaction and photography opportunities before returning to Jinka Airport for your afternoon flight back to Addis Ababa.

In the evening, enjoy a traditional farewell dinner with Ethiopian music and dance performances before your international departure flight.
